The Flash Star Ezra Miller Threatens To Kill Members Of Ku Klux Klan

He said if one chapter of the KKK didn't kill themselves then he was coming after them.

Stewart Perrie

Stewart Perrie

google discoverFollow us on Google Discover

Ezra Miller has gone on a bizarre rant on social media and has threatened to kill members of the Ku Klux Klan.

The Flash star specifically called out 'the Beulaville chapter of the North Carolina Ku Klux Klan' in his cryptic video on Instagram, however it's not immediately clear what he's accusing them of doing.

He indicated they knew why they were being called out by the Hollywood star.

Miller delivered a fairly intense message to them, saying: "Hello, first of all, how are y'all doing.

"It's me! If y'all wanna die I suggest just killing yourselves with your own guns. Ok?

"Otherwise, keep doing exactly what you're doing, right - and you know what I'm talking about - and we'll do it for you if that's what you really want. OK, talk to you soon, OK? Bye!"

He added in the Instagram caption that his message is definitely not a joke and he means business.

Ezra said: "Please disseminate (gross!) this video to all those whom it may concern.

"This is not a joke and even though I do recognize myself to be a clown please trust me and take this seriously. Let's save some live now ok babies?"

Beulaville is found in Duplin County, in North Carolina. It's fairly small based off the 2020 census, which showed there were only 1,116 people living there.

According to NCpedia, there have been three eras of Ku Klux Klan influence in North Carolina over the years.

The third and most modern eras appeared in the mid-1940s and had practically disappeared by the end of the 1990s, in terms of membership, due to 'internal conflicts over policy and leadership'.

So, it's unclear what Miller was suggesting in his video or what the Beulaville chapter of the North Carolina Ku Klux Klan has done recently that would warrant a shoutout from a big-name actor.
